- the present invention relates to a device for the application of a coating composition on a travelling web, particularly a paper web.
- the device is of the type com ⁇ prising a transfer roll, a support roll cooperating the- rewith, the web travelling in a nip between said rolls.
- the device further comprises a gravure roll intended for the application of an adapted quantity of the coating composition on the transfer roll for further transfer to the travelling web.
- a traditional so called flexo coater has for a function to transfer onto a travelling paper web a prede ⁇ termined layer defined by a gravure roll.
- This gravure roll is via a dosage roll supplied with an excess of a composition which is pressed into the valleys of the gravure roll, and with a blade or a doctor 5 the excess composition on the gravure roll is removed so that after this doctoring step only the valleys of the gravure roll are filled with composition.
- the material is transferred onto a transfer roll which in turn moves the material over to the surface of the paper web.
- the composition is contained in a van, wherein the dosage roll is dipped into the composi ⁇ tion and transferred therefrom to the dosage nip between the dosage roll and the gravure roll.
- the blade or doctor is of a so called pushing type which is mainly used in all applica ⁇ tions where the function is to scrape a travelling sur ⁇ face, for example a roll surface.
- the surface of the gravure roll is to be scraped clean so that the present composition only is found in the valleys of the gravure roll.
- flexo coaters An important area of use for flexo coaters is the application of microcapsules in the manufacture of so called NCR-paper.

- An example of a modified form of flexo coaters is found in EP-A1 0 037 682 where, as is clear from figure 1, the gravure roll is dipped into the coating composi ⁇ tion, the excess composition being removed by means of a pushing doctor in a conventional manner.
- the present invention has for its object to improve the function of the flexo coater in several respects.
- One object of the present invention is to improve the function of the doctor with regard to wear of the gravure roll.
- Another object is to provide reduced wear of the doctor blade.
- Another object of the invention is to eliminate the problem of sedimentation in the fountain tray.
- the present invention provides for a device for the application of a coating composition on a travelling web, particularly a paper web.
- the device comprises a transfer roll, a support roll cooperating with the transfer roll, and the travelling web is fed in a nip between said rolls.
- the device further comprises a gravure roll intended for the transfer of an adapted qu ⁇ antity of the coating composition onto the transfer roll for further conveyance to the travelling web.
- the device according to the invention comprises me ⁇ ans for passing of the web through said nip.
- the device according to the invention is characteri ⁇ zed by blade means for the removal of excess of coating composition from the gravure roll, said blade means being arranged in trailing position in relation to the moving surface of the gravure roll.
- said bla ⁇ de means is arranged under an angle in relation to the moving surface of the gravure roll of less than about 45°. A preferred angle is from about 10 to about 30°.
- the device according to the invention is suitably provided with application means for the application of the coating composition on the moving surface of the gravure roll upstream of said blade means.
- This applica- tin means comprises in one embodiment a tube extending across the full width of the travelling web and being provided with a slit or a row of nozzles extending along said tube.
- the application means can comprise a dosage roll cooperating with the gravure roll to the formation of a pool of coating composition up- stream of said blade means.
- the device according to the present invention is suitably provided with a fountain tray for the recovery of excess coating composition. It is furthermore suitable that the movable surfaces of the rolls move pair-wise in the same direction.
- the invention is particularly applicable to the coa ⁇ ting of paper webs. It is furthermore particularly pre ⁇ ferred to use said device according to the invention for the application of coating compositions containing mic- rocapsules used in carbon-free copying paper.

- Figure 1 shows diagrammatically a traditional so called flexo coater generally designated 1 for one-sided coating of a travelling paper web 17.
- This flexo coater consists of a number of main components, namely a support roll 3 and a transfer roll 5, between which the paper web 17 travels in the direction indicated in the figure.
- the flexo coater furthermore comprises a gravure roll 17 ha ⁇ ving a patterned surface, and a dosage roll 9.
- the coa ⁇ ting composition 19 is contained in a fountain tray 15 wherein the dosage roll 9 with its lower part rotates in the coating composition 19.
- coating composi ⁇ tion is picked up with a dosage roll 9 and transferred to the surface of the gravure roll 7.
- the excess of coating composition is removed by means of a doctor blade 11 car ⁇ ried in a blade holder 13. This doctor blade is arranged in a pushing position in relation to the rotating gravure roll 7.
- Coating composition is volumetrically transferred from the gravure roll 7 onto the transfer roll 5 for further conveyance to the lower side of the travelling web 17.
- the dipping procedure for pickung up the coating composition by means of the dosage roll 9 in accordance with prior art involves inconveniences in connection with the presence of the composition in the fountain tray 15.
- the coating composition used in the above described area for the manufacture of NCR-paper consists of a dispersion containing lighter and heavier particles. In view of this sedimentation in the traditional dipping trays occurs and particles assemble in the areas of the tray where the liquid flow is low.

- Figure 4 shows diagrammatically in a sideview the relation between doctor blade 11 and gravure roll 7 with regard to the position of doctor blade 11.
- the angle ⁇ between a plane through the doctor blade 11 and a tangent through the point of engagement of the doctor blade 11 against the gravure roll 7 corresponds at a value exce ⁇ eding 90° so called pushing position of the doctor blade 13, whereas in angle ⁇ lower than 90° corresponds to trailing position of the blade.
- Pushing position results in high wear of the doctor blade and also high wear on the gravure roll. Furthermore, pushing position results in the forma ⁇ tion of deposits of dried coating composition on the front or exit side of doctor blade 11.
- a doctor blade is used in trailing position, i.e. the angle ⁇ is less than 90° and is preferably less than about 45° and lies particularly within the range about 10 to about 30°.
- a hydrodyna ⁇ mic fluid pressure will be generated in the wedge behind the blade. This fluid pressure results in a certain lif- ting force on the blade which can be balanced against the outer force on the blade so that a fluid film can be cre ⁇ ated between the highest points of the roll surface and the blade. In this manner the metallic contact between doctor blade and roll will be eliminated or considerably reduced which, of course, is essential from the point of view of wear.
- the hydrodynamic pressure in the wedge behind the doctor blade also assists in effectively pressing the coating composition into the valleys of the roll surface, whereby complete filling of the valleys will be ensured.
- the use of a trailing blade also reduces the problem of deposits on the exit side of the blade which results in improved eveness of the metered film.
